      Theo, likes to fall off the wagon. About a month ago, after a game, he (and many team members) visited a strip club and got into an altercation. The incident became very public and lot's of players had to make explanations to spouses and gfs. Theo had to make even more explanations. Up to then, the Hawks were positioned well for the playoffs. Since then, I think they've only won two games and are poised for an early summer. Most media and fans are pointing to that incident as the turning point in the Hawks season.

                    The favorites are still the Red Wings, the Avs, the Devils, the Leafs, and--maybe--the Stars.

                    I put the Canucks a tier below these teams; they might very well be the most talented and exciting team in the league, but goaltending will remain a question mark in the playoffs until Cloutier shows he can win.

                    Now, one could say the same thing about the Stars with Marty Turco. However, I watched Turco as a four year starter with the University of Michigan, including a couple of NCAA titles. The man in CLUTCH. In four years at U-M, he never--and I mean, never--lost a game in which he went into the third period with a lead. I believe his record was 103-0-2 when leading after two periods. That's insane. I don't know if he will translate that level of success to the NHL playoffs, but I'd be a fool to bet against him. If I had to pick a team to win it all right now, it'd be the Stars.
